
在TP钱包出现“最后交易无法广播或确认”的场景中,问题往往不是孤立的单点故障,而是节点网络、数据处理、安全链路与支付逻辑交互后显现的症状。本文以白皮书式的方法论,给出可落地的分析流程与行业化建议。
问题概述与分层判定:
首先将故障划分为三类状态:未广播(本地签名未发送)、已广播未入池(网络或节点拒绝)、已入池但长时间未上链(费率/链拥堵/回滚)。对每类状态分别采集RPC返回值、节点同步高度、mempool快照与本地签名日志,为后续定位提供证据链。
详细分析流程:
1) 节点网络层:核验peer数量、连接稳定性、区块高度差以及链重组频率。建议部署多节点多地域冗余、启用交叉广播策略并对等节点进行版本与规则一致性检测。指标:peer count、p2p RTT、区块延迟分布。
2) 高性能数据处理:构建流式日志与并行解析管道,实时计算memphttps://www.xingyuecoffee.com ,ool大小、gas price百分位、nonce冲突率与重试计数。使用时间序列数据库与索引化存储,支持故障回放与交易重放测试,缩短定位时延。
3) 安全工具链:审计签名模块、助记词导入流程与硬件安全模块(HSM/TEE)。引入签名回放防护、密钥使用监控与多签策略,确保签名失败不是因密钥隔离或权限误判。
4) 智能化支付解决方案:采用动态费率引擎(基于链上数据与预言机)、分层广播策略(先局部,再全网)与支付通道/聚合交易以降低链上确认依赖。利用机器学习预测短期拥堵并自动调整重试策略。
行业透视与未来趋势:
钱包可靠性将更加依赖去中心化基础设施与跨链中继的健壮性。未来的演进方向包括基于ML的网络健康预警、自适应链上费用市场、以及结合TEE的端到端可信签名体系。高性能数据平台将成为实时风控、回滚恢复与治理决策的核心。

落地建议:
建立标准化故障复现流程、节点多活与日志指标化、自动化告警与回放实验室,结合周期性安全审计与回归测试,形成从节点到支付的闭环治理。只有将技术链条视为整体,才能从根源上降低“最后一刻”交易失败率,提升用户信任与产品可用性。
评论
TechFan
这篇分析很实用,节点多活和交叉广播是我之前忽略的点。
张小白
对于高性能数据处理部分,希望能看到具体工具链推荐和监控指标模板。
CryptoLee
智能费率引擎与预言机结合的思路很前沿,值得在测试网验证。
未来观测者
安全工具链的强调到位,特别是TEE与多签的结合,对抗私钥失效场景很有帮助。